Assessing Your Home's Solar Prospective



Before diving into solar panel setup, you should examine your home's solar potential. Start by inspecting your roof's alignment and incline; south-facing roofings usually capture the most sunlight.



Look for any kind of blockages, like trees or high structures, that can cast darkness on your panels. These can substantially lower power production. Consider your local climate as well; sunny areas yield better results than constantly gloomy areas.

Next, evaluate your energy needs and use patterns to figure out how many panels you'll need. You may also wish to make use of on the internet solar calculators or consult with a professional to get a clearer picture.

Panel Efficiency Scores



As you discover the world of solar panels, recognizing panel efficiency rankings is critical for making an informed decision. These scores suggest just how successfully a panel converts sunlight into functional power. The greater the efficiency, the much more power you'll produce from a smaller sized space. Many property panels range from 15% to 22% performance.

When picking your panels, consider your power needs and readily available roof space. If you have actually restricted room, going with higher-efficiency panels could be useful. Nevertheless, if you have adequate roofing area, lower-efficiency panels might be sufficient.

Setup Type Options



Choosing the appropriate setup kind for solar panels can significantly impact your system's efficiency and efficiency. You'll usually encounter 2 primary alternatives: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are frequently the go-to choice for home owners, as they make use of existing room and can be less expensive to set up. Nevertheless, if your roof isn't appropriate-- possibly due to shielding or architectural concerns-- ground-mounted systems might be the better alternative.

They permit optimal positioning, making best use of sunlight exposure. Furthermore, you can change their angle to improve effectiveness.

Prior to deciding, think about aspects like offered area, spending plan, and local guidelines. Visual Factors to consider



While functionality is important, visual appeals shouldn't be overlooked when selecting solar panels for your home. You want panels that not only job efficiently however also enhance your home's layout.

Think about the shade and dimension of the solar panels; black panels often mix effortlessly with dark roofings, while blue panels might attract attention more. Check out choices like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that replace conventional roofing products, using a smooth appearance.

You might likewise discover solar tiles, which mimic conventional roofing and can boost aesthetic appeal. Don't fail to remember to assess the format and positioning of the panels to make the most of both efficiency and visual consistency.

Ultimately, striking the right equilibrium in between performance and visual appeals will make your solar financial investment a lot more rewarding.
